Iconic Landmarks: Must-See Attractions on the Map

Seattle’s iconic landmarks offer a captivating glimpse into its rich history and vibrant culture, making them must-see attractions on any scenic overlook map. From towering skyscrapers to historic buildings and breathtaking natural wonders, these landmarks are testaments to the city’s evolution and provide visitors with an authentic Seattle experience. One of the most recognizable symbols is the Space Needle, standing tall at 605 feet (184 meters), offering panoramic views that showcase the city’s skyline and surrounding mountains. This iconic structure, completed in 1962 for the World’s Fair, has become a defining feature of Seattle’s horizon.

Another notable landmark, Pike Place Market, is not just a bustling marketplace but also a cultural institution. Established in 1907, it is one of the oldest continuously operating farmers markets in the United States and a hub for local artisans, merchants, and food vendors.
